MAULstandard Pin Board Assembly Instructions
Model Numbers: 644 14, 644 18, 644 22, 644 60, 644 64, 644 68, 644 70
Included Parts
- 1x MAULstandard Pin Board with metal frame
- 2x Metal mounting brackets
- 2x Wall plugs
- 4x Ø 4 x 30 mm screws
- 4x Ø 6 x 30 mm screws
Assembly Guide
This guide provides instructions for assembling the MAULstandard pin board. The included mounting hardware is intended for use on solid wall surfaces.
Mounting Bracket Placement
The mounting brackets can be attached to the wall in two configurations:
- Angled Mounting (Diagram A): Brackets are affixed to the wall at a 30-degree angle. A vertical clearance of 25 mm is maintained from the top edge of the board to the bracket's attachment point.
- Vertical Mounting (Diagram B): Brackets are affixed vertically. A vertical clearance of 24 mm is maintained from the top edge of the board to the bracket's attachment point.
General Installation Details
Ensure a minimum horizontal distance of 70 mm from the sides of the pin board to the wall mounting points.
Drilling and Fastening:
- Required drill hole sizes for mounting include Ø 3.5 mm and Ø 2.5 mm for the smaller screws (Ø 4 x 30 mm), and Ø 8 mm and Ø 6 mm for the larger screws (Ø 6 x 30 mm) and wall plugs.
- Use the appropriate screws and wall plugs for your specific wall type.
Important Safety Information
The enclosed mounting materials are exclusively for assembly on solid and firm surfaces such as solid masonry, full bricks, concrete, or solid wood walls with a wall covering of no more than 3 mm thickness. It is crucial to verify the suitability of the wall/ceiling construction and the mounting materials to withstand the forces involved. Improper assembly can pose a risk to the user. Assembly should only be performed by qualified personnel. For other or unknown wall surfaces, consult a specialist.
